York Region Physiotherapy and Rehab - King City Staff

Sophie Bourget, BSc., PT, M.C.P.A

Sophie graduated with a BSc., PT from Laval University in 1995. She has taken numerous post-graduate courses in orthopedic physiotherapy, mostly in the areas of manual and manipulative therapy, and is working towards receiving her Diploma of Intermediate Orthopedic Manual and Manipulative Physiotherapy with the Canadian Physiotherapy Association.

After graduating from University, Sophie worked in the State of Missouri (United States) for almost 3 years, for Kirksville Osteopathic Medical Centre, and for the Health and Fitness Center attached to the Hospital. She moved to Ontario and opened her first clinic, York Region Physiotherapy and Rehab Inc., in the year 2000 and began offering physiotherapy services to the residents of King City.

Once it became known about the quality of care provided by York Region Physiotherapy, and recognizing that many clients were coming from the surrounding areas, Sophie decided to open a second clinic in the town of Newmarket in the year 2002.

Now with two locations, York Region Physiotherapy is better able to serve a growing population. Sophie believes in quality of care, and is determined to continue providing the best services possible.
